Wat is een IP-adres en een subnetmasker, in eenvoudige bewoordingen?

IP-adressen en subnetmaskers vormen de kern van computernetwerken. Het zijn geen concepten die in hun geheel gemakkelijk te begrijpen zijn, zeker als je geen technische achtergrond hebt. Met een beetje hulp kan iedereen echter de basisprincipes van IP-adressen en subnetmaskers begrijpen, wat ze doen en waarom ze nuttig zijn. Als je wilt weten wat een IP-adres is, wat het doel is van een internetprotocoladres of wat een subnetmasker is, lees dan verder. We leggen het allemaal in eenvoudige bewoordingen uit:

Wat is een IP-adres? Wat is het doel van een Internet Protocol -adres?

Laten we, om u te helpen begrijpen wat IP-adressen zijn, in eenvoudige bewoordingen, een analogie uit het echte leven gebruiken:

U wilt een schriftelijke brief naar een vriend sturen. U bent klaar met het schrijven van het bericht en wilt het verzenden. Om de brief op zijn bestemming te krijgen, moet je het adres van je vriend weten - straatnaam, nummer en postcode - en dit op de brief schrijven. Anders weet de post niet waar ze je brief moeten bezorgen.

Net zoals een brief een bestemming nodig heeft, hebben gegevens ook een IP-adres nodig om er te komen

Zie een IP-adres als het adres van een computer of apparaat in een netwerk(Think of an IP address as the address of a computer or device inside a network) . De IP-adressen zijn de unieke identificatiegegevens van netwerkapparaten die worden gebruikt om communicatie tot stand te brengen, gegevens te verzenden en te ontvangen van of naar andere computers of apparaten in hetzelfde netwerk of op internet.

Op dit moment zijn er twee relevante standaarden voor IP ( Internet Protocol ) adressen: IP versie 4 (IPv4)(IP version 4 (IPv4)) en IP versie 6 (IPv6)(IP version 6 (IPv6)) . We gaan uitleggen wat deze normen betekenen in de volgende twee secties van deze gids, dus wacht nog even met ons.

U moet ook weten dat een IP-adres statisch of dynamisch kan zijn(an IP address can be either static or dynamic) . Een statisch IP-adres is een adres dat u zelf moet configureren via de netwerkinstellingen van Windows . Een dynamisch adres wordt toegewezen door het Dynamic Host Configuration Protocol (DHCP) , meestal voor een beperkte tijdsperiode(limited time frame) . DHCP is een service die wordt uitgevoerd op speciale servers in uw netwerk of op gespecialiseerde netwerkhardware, zoals draadloze routers. Dynamische IP(Dynamic IP)adressen worden het meest gebruikt, omdat statische adressen netwerkproblemen kunnen veroorzaken als ze onzorgvuldig worden gebruikt. Statische IP-adressen zijn ook moeilijker te beheren, omdat ze handmatige tussenkomst vereisen om te creëren en te beheren, vooral in grotere netwerken zoals die van kantoren of instellingen.

Zo worden in een typisch thuisnetwerk of een klein bedrijfsnetwerk IP-adressen automatisch toegewezen en beheerd door de router via DHCP .

Wat is een Internet Protocol versie 4(Internet Protocol Version 4) ( IPv4 ) adres?

IP versie 4 (IPv4)(IP version 4 (IPv4)) is momenteel de meest gebruikte standaard. IPv4 gebruikt 32-bits adressen, wat de adresruimte beperkt tot 4.294.967.296 (2^32) mogelijke unieke adressen. Zodat iedereen ze gemakkelijk kan begrijpen, worden IPv4- adressen weergegeven door vier decimale getallen gescheiden door punten. Elk van deze vier cijfers bevat één tot drie cijfers en elk van hen kan variëren van 0 tot 255. Een IPv4 -adres kan er bijvoorbeeld als volgt uitzien: 172.217.3.100.

Een voorbeeld van een IP-adres

IPv4- adressen zijn onderverdeeld in drie categorieën, klassen genaamd. Zoals u in de onderstaande tabel kunt zien, is het belangrijkste verschil tussen elke klasse het aantal bits dat is toegewezen voor netwerk- en hostidentificatie. Ook kan de klasse waaruit een IPv4 -adres komt, worden geïdentificeerd aan de hand van de vorm van de leidende bits van het eerste gehele getal, van punt-decimale notatie. Het IP-adres in de bovenstaande afbeelding is bijvoorbeeld een IP-adres van klasse B(B IP) omdat de leidende bits van de binaire vorm van 172 (10101100) 1 en 0 (10)(1 and 0 (10)) zijn .

Klassen van IPv4-adressen: A, B en C

Er zijn ook andere adressen die voor bepaalde acties worden gebruikt. Zoals u in de onderstaande tabel kunt zien, worden de klasse D(class D) IPv4-adressen gebruikt voor multicast-adressering(multicast addressing) . In computernetwerken verwijst multicast naar groepscommunicatie waarbij informatie tegelijkertijd wordt geadresseerd aan een groep bestemmingscomputers. Multicast-adressering wordt bijvoorbeeld gebruikt bij internettelevisie(Internet) en multipoint-videoconferenties. De klasse E IPv4-(class E IPv4) adressen kunnen niet in het echte leven worden gebruikt, omdat ze alleen op experimentele manieren worden gebruikt.

Speciale klassen van IPv4-adressen: D en E

Omdat de wereld echter geen combinaties meer heeft voor IP-adressen, wordt IPv4 momenteel uitgefaseerd. Om meer netwerkapparaten toe te voegen, moeten we daarom overschakelen naar IPv6 , omdat we hierdoor veel meer IP-adressen kunnen gebruiken.

Wat is een Internet Protocol versie 6(Internet Protocol Version 6) ( IPv6 ) adres?

Internet Protocol versie 6(Internet Protocol version 6) of IPv6 is in 1995 gemaakt om IPv4- adressen te vervangen. IP-versie 6 (IPv6)(IP version 6 (IPv6)) is een standaard die nog niet op grote schaal is geïmplementeerd, maar dat wel zal zijn zodra alle IPv4- adressen op zijn. IPv6 -adressen bestaan ​​uit groepen van acht cijfers, gescheiden door dubbele punten. In tegenstelling tot de IPv4- adressen kunnen deze ook letters van a tot en met f bevatten , dus een IPv6 -adres zou er zo uit kunnen zien: 2a00:1450:400d:0802:0000:0000:0000:200e. Ter vergelijking met IPv4, kan deze standaard 2^128 adressen beheren. Het maximale aantal adressen is een enorm aantal met 39 cijfers, en dat zou de komende decennia moeten voldoen aan onze behoefte aan IP-adressen.

Een voorbeeld van een IPv6-adres

Zoals je op de afbeelding hierboven kunt zien, zijn de IPv6 - adressen behoorlijk uitdagend om te beheren. Er zijn dus enkele regels die de manier waarop u deze adressen schrijft vereenvoudigen. Als een of meer groepen "0000" zijn, kunnen de nullen worden weggelaten en vervangen door twee dubbele punten (::) en de nullen aan het begin van een groep kunnen ook worden weggelaten. Ook zijn de IPv6 -adressen , in tegenstelling tot IPv4 , niet ingedeeld in klassen.

OPMERKING:(NOTE:) Als u het IP-adres van uw computer of apparaat wilt weten of wilt weten hoe u dit kunt wijzigen, lees dan:

Wat is een subnetmasker? Waar wordt een subnetmasker voor gebruikt?

Een subnetmasker is een manier om een ​​IP-netwerk op te splitsen. U kunt het zien als het netnummer van uw telefoonnummer. In eenvoudige bewoordingen worden subnetmaskers in netwerken gebruikt om ze in twee of meer subnetwerken te splitsen, waardoor ze gemakkelijker te beheren zijn. Op thuisnetwerken en kleine bedrijfsnetwerken bevinden al uw netwerkcomputers en apparaten zich meestal op hetzelfde subnet, dus alle computers of apparaten die zich op hetzelfde subnet bevinden, hebben hetzelfde subnetmasker.

Om wat technischer te worden: een subnetmasker is een 32-bits nummer dat een IP-adres maskeert en het IP-adres verdeelt in een netwerkadres en een hostadres. Het subnetmasker wordt gemaakt door netwerkbits in te stellen op allemaal "1" en hostbits op allemaal "0".

Het subnetmasker kan op twee manieren worden weergegeven: de ene is de gebruikelijke punt-decimale notatie zoals een IP-adres, en de tweede gebruikt de CIDR-notatie(CIDR notation) .

Een subnetmasker weergegeven in punt-decimale notatie

In CIDR -notatie wordt een subnetmasker gespecificeerd als het eerste IP-adres van een netwerk, gevolgd door een schuine streep (/) en de bitlengte van het subnetprefix. In plaats van bijvoorbeeld het IP-adres zoals 192.168.1.0 en het subnetmasker zoals 255.255.255.0 te schrijven, kunt u alleen het adres schrijven, gevolgd door een schuine streep en de bitlengte van het voorvoegsel, wat het aantal bits is "1 " van de binaire vorm van het subnetmasker: 192.168.1.0/24. Helaas is het niet eenvoudig om de lengte van het subnet prefix te berekenen, dus als je het wilt of moet doen, raden we je aan tools zoals deze online IP Subnet Calculator te gebruiken .

Een subnetmasker weergegeven in CIDR-notatie (lengte subnetprefix)

Het subnetmasker wordt gebruikt in het subnetting-proces, waarbij het netwerk wordt opgedeeld in kleinere delen die subnetten worden genoemd. Zoals u weet, is een IP-adres verdeeld in twee delen, één voor netwerkidentificatie en één voor hostidentificatie. Met behulp van het subnetmasker wordt het hoofdnetwerk opgedeeld in een of meer kleinere netwerken. Dit wordt uitgevoerd door een bitsgewijze EN-bewerking tussen het IP-adres en het (sub)netwerkmasker. Simpel gezegd betekent dit dat een deel van de bits van het hostnummer(host number) wordt gebruikt voor de nieuwe (sub)netwerkidentificatie.

Subnetmaskers worden gebruikt om subnetten te maken door de host-ID te delen

Als u wilt weten hoe u het subnetmasker op uw Windows 10-pc's en op alle computers en apparaten in uw lokale thuisnetwerk kunt wijzigen, leest u deze handleiding: 4 manieren om het subnetmasker in Windows 10 te wijzigen(4 ways to change the Subnet Mask in Windows 10) .

Wat zijn DNS, Gateway, WINS?

We realiseren ons dat dit onderwerp wat technischer is, hoewel we proberen om zoveel mogelijk eenvoudige termen te gebruiken, dus hier is een korte en vriendelijke versie van wat al deze complementaire begrippen betekenen. Het is beter als u weet wat ze betekenen, want om te begrijpen hoe een IP-adres werkt, moet u ook deze aanvullende onderwerpen begrijpen die samenwerken om de communicatie tussen onze netwerkcomputers en apparaten mogelijk te maken.

Dus, zonder verder oponthoud, hier is een korte beschrijving van hen:

  • Gateway - een gateway is meestal een router op het netwerk die fungeert als toegangspunt tot een ander netwerk en internet. Uw internetprovider(Internet Service Provider) heeft bijvoorbeeld een of meerdere gatewayservers die uw computer gebruikt om verbinding te maken met internet. In grote zakelijke omgevingen worden gateways ook gebruikt om de verschillende subnetten/netwerken die eigendom zijn van het bedrijf met elkaar te verbinden.
  • DNS-server - het staat voor Domain Name System , en het is een naamgevingssysteem voor apparaten en computers met internetverbinding dat gemakkelijk te onthouden adressen, zoals www.digitalcitizen.life, koppelt aan hun IP-adres. Als uw DNS -server niet werkt, kunt u niet op internet surfen met traditionele website-adressen. De DNS-server wordt meestal geleverd door uw internetprovider(Internet Service Provider) . Een uitgebreidere uitleg vind je hier: Wat is DNS? Hoe is het nuttig? (What is DNS? How is it useful?). U kunt de DNS- servers echter ook zelf wijzigen. Lees er meer over op 3 manieren om de DNS-instellingen in Windows 10 te wijzigen(3 ways to change the DNS settings in Windows 10) enWat is een DNS-server van een derde partij? 8 redenen om openbare DNS-servers te(What is a third party DNS server? 8 reasons to use public DNS servers) gebruiken
  • WINS Server - het staat voor Windows Internet Name Service en het is een verouderd type naamgevingssysteem dat werd gebruikt op oudere computers en Microsoft -besturingssystemen, zoals Windows 98 of Windows 2000 . Het werd gebruikt om IP-adressen dynamisch aan computernamen toe te wijzen. DNS- servers worden nu echter voor deze taak gebruikt omdat ze beter presteren.

Heeft u vragen over IP-adressen of subnetmaskers?

Nu u een basiskennis hebt van wat IP-adressen en subnetmaskers zijn, zou u de netwerkinstellingen van uw Windows - apparaten vrij eenvoudig moeten kunnen configureren. Heeft u nog vragen over IP-adressen of subnetmaskers? Vraag(Ask) het in de reacties hieronder en we zullen ons best doen om te helpen.



About the author

Ik ben een softwareontwikkelaar met meer dan 10 jaar ervaring. Ik ben gespecialiseerd in Mac-programmering en heb duizenden regels code geschreven voor verschillende Mac-programma's, waaronder maar niet beperkt tot: TextEdit, GarageBand, iMovie en Inkscape. Ook heb ik ervaring met Linux en Windows ontwikkeling. Dankzij mijn vaardigheden als ontwikkelaar kan ik hoogwaardige, uitgebreide tutorials schrijven voor verschillende softwareontwikkelingsplatforms - van macOS tot Linux - waardoor mijn tutorials de perfecte keuze zijn voor diegenen die meer willen weten over de tools die ze gebruiken.



Related posts